2011-07-06 11 views
3

のは、私はそうのように、HTMLのハイパーリンクの表現を持っているとしましょう:WatiN Linkオブジェクトから生のhref属性を取得するにはどうすればよいですか?

<a href="/">Home</a> 

私が言ったリンクのWatiN.Core.Link表現を取得した場合、私はそののhref属性を検査したいはずです。しかし、LinkオブジェクトのGetAttributeValue( "href")を呼び出すと、生のhref値( "/")が返されず、絶対URL:http:// myserver/に変換されます。

生のhref値(この場合は「/」)を取得するにはどうすればよいですか?

答えて

2

WatiNは、href属性の翻訳を回避するのいずれかの直接的な方法を持っていないようです:(少なくとも、私はメーリングリストwatin、ユーザーに言われてきたものに行く。

+2

主な課題があることですIEはhref属性から完全なURLを返します。これはWatiNの問題ではなく、IEの問題です。 – JimEvans

+0

Aha、興味深いsnafuです。 – aknuds1

関連する問題